public class EventFluent<A extends EventFluent<A>>
extends io.fabric8.kubernetes.api.builder.BaseFluent<A>
| Modifier and Type | Class and Description |
|---|---|
class |
EventFluent.EventTimeNested<N> |
class |
EventFluent.InvolvedObjectNested<N> |
class |
EventFluent.MetadataNested<N> |
class |
EventFluent.RelatedNested<N> |
class |
EventFluent.SeriesNested<N> |
class |
EventFluent.SourceNested<N> |
| Constructor and Description |
|---|
EventFluent() |
EventFluent(Event instance) |
public EventFluent()
public EventFluent(Event instance)
protected void copyInstance(Event instance)
public String getAction()
public boolean hasAction()
public String getApiVersion()
public boolean hasApiVersion()
public Integer getCount()
public boolean hasCount()
public MicroTime buildEventTime()
public boolean hasEventTime()
public EventFluent.EventTimeNested<A> withNewEventTime()
public EventFluent.EventTimeNested<A> withNewEventTimeLike(MicroTime item)
public EventFluent.EventTimeNested<A> editEventTime()
public EventFluent.EventTimeNested<A> editOrNewEventTime()
public EventFluent.EventTimeNested<A> editOrNewEventTimeLike(MicroTime item)
public String getFirstTimestamp()
public boolean hasFirstTimestamp()
public ObjectReference buildInvolvedObject()
public A withInvolvedObject(ObjectReference involvedObject)
public boolean hasInvolvedObject()
public EventFluent.InvolvedObjectNested<A> withNewInvolvedObject()
public EventFluent.InvolvedObjectNested<A> withNewInvolvedObjectLike(ObjectReference item)
public EventFluent.InvolvedObjectNested<A> editInvolvedObject()
public EventFluent.InvolvedObjectNested<A> editOrNewInvolvedObject()
public EventFluent.InvolvedObjectNested<A> editOrNewInvolvedObjectLike(ObjectReference item)
public String getKind()
public boolean hasKind()
public String getLastTimestamp()
public boolean hasLastTimestamp()
public String getMessage()
public boolean hasMessage()
public ObjectMeta buildMetadata()
public A withMetadata(ObjectMeta metadata)
public boolean hasMetadata()
public EventFluent.MetadataNested<A> withNewMetadata()
public EventFluent.MetadataNested<A> withNewMetadataLike(ObjectMeta item)
public EventFluent.MetadataNested<A> editMetadata()
public EventFluent.MetadataNested<A> editOrNewMetadata()
public EventFluent.MetadataNested<A> editOrNewMetadataLike(ObjectMeta item)
public String getReason()
public boolean hasReason()
public ObjectReference buildRelated()
public A withRelated(ObjectReference related)
public boolean hasRelated()
public EventFluent.RelatedNested<A> withNewRelated()
public EventFluent.RelatedNested<A> withNewRelatedLike(ObjectReference item)
public EventFluent.RelatedNested<A> editRelated()
public EventFluent.RelatedNested<A> editOrNewRelated()
public EventFluent.RelatedNested<A> editOrNewRelatedLike(ObjectReference item)
public String getReportingComponent()
public boolean hasReportingComponent()
public String getReportingInstance()
public boolean hasReportingInstance()
public EventSeries buildSeries()
public A withSeries(EventSeries series)
public boolean hasSeries()
public EventFluent.SeriesNested<A> withNewSeries()
public EventFluent.SeriesNested<A> withNewSeriesLike(EventSeries item)
public EventFluent.SeriesNested<A> editSeries()
public EventFluent.SeriesNested<A> editOrNewSeries()
public EventFluent.SeriesNested<A> editOrNewSeriesLike(EventSeries item)
public EventSource buildSource()
public A withSource(EventSource source)
public boolean hasSource()
public EventFluent.SourceNested<A> withNewSource()
public EventFluent.SourceNested<A> withNewSourceLike(EventSource item)
public EventFluent.SourceNested<A> editSource()
public EventFluent.SourceNested<A> editOrNewSource()
public EventFluent.SourceNested<A> editOrNewSourceLike(EventSource item)
public String getType()
public boolean hasType()
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
public boolean hasAdditionalProperties()
public boolean equals(Object o)
equals in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ends EventFluent<A>>public int hashCode()
hashCode in class io.fabric8.kubernetes.api.builder.BaseFluent<A extends EventFluent<A>>Copyright © 2015–2024 Red Hat. All rights reserved.